Speed Up Your Internet: Simple Tweaks for a Faster Online Experience
Frustrated with sluggish internet speeds? Don't despair! While complex internet infrastructure might seem daunting, many simple tweaks can dramatically improve your online experience. Here's a guide to boosting your internet speed:
1. Location, Location, Location:
Your router's position plays a crucial role in signal strength. Try moving it closer to your device, ensuring an unobstructed path between them. Avoid placing it near walls, large metal objects, or other electronic devices that could interfere with the signal.
2. Cable Management:
Examine your internet cables. Are they tangled, frayed, or damaged? Replace faulty cables, and ensure they're properly connected to both your router and device. Even a loose connection can significantly impact speed.
3. Clear the Clutter:
Browser history, cookies, and cache can accumulate over time, slowing down your browsing. Regularly clearing your browser history can free up space and improve performance. Additionally, consider using a browser extension like "CCleaner" for a more thorough clean-up.
4. Keep It Updated:
Outdated browsers can be inefficient. Ensure your browser is up-to-date, as newer versions often include speed optimizations. Additionally, update your operating system and device drivers regularly to ensure compatibility and performance improvements.
5. Virus Check:
Malicious software can slow down your internet connection. Run a virus scan on your device to detect and remove any threats. Consider installing a reputable antivirus software for ongoing protection.
6. Close the Hogs:
Applications running in the background can consume valuable bandwidth and slow down your internet. Identify and close unnecessary applications, especially those known for resource-intensive tasks like video streaming or large file downloads.
7. Restart, Refresh, Repeat:
Sometimes, a simple reboot of your router and device can solve unexpected slowdowns. This resets connections and clears any temporary glitches that may be hindering performance.
8. Consider a Speed Test:
Before making significant changes, run an internet speed test to establish your baseline speed. After implementing these tips, run another test to measure the improvement and identify any areas for further optimization.
